Complete Buyer's Guide: How to Choose Battery Storage for Solar Power
1. Understanding Battery Capacity and Your Needs
Capacity, measured in watt-hours (Wh), determines how long your battery can power devices. For example, a 300Wh unit might run a phone for days but a fridge for only hours. Match capacity to your usage – small outings need 100-500Wh, while home backup requires 1000Wh or more.
2. Choosing the Right Battery Technology
LiFePO4 (lithium iron phosphate) batteries last longer and are safer than traditional lithium-ion, with thousands of cycles. If you plan to use your storage frequently, prioritize LiFePO4 for durability.
3. Output Power and Device Compatibility
Output wattage (e.g., 300W vs 2000W) affects what appliances you can run. Pure sine wave AC outlets are essential for sensitive electronics like laptops. Check your devices’ wattage requirements to avoid overloading the system.
4. Solar Charging Efficiency and Compatibility
Look for MPPT controllers for faster solar charging, and ensure compatibility with your panels’ voltage. Some units include solar panels, which can save money and hassle. Higher solar input watts mean quicker recharges off-grid.
5. Portability vs Stationary Design
Portable power stations are great for mobility but have limited capacity, while stationary units like powerwalls offer massive storage for homes. Consider weight and size if you’ll move it frequently.
6. Safety and Protection Features
Built-in BMS (battery management system) protects against overcharging, short circuits, and overheating. Look for certifications and cooling systems to ensure safe operation, especially for long-term use.
7. Warranty and Brand Support
Warranties range from 1 to 10 years – longer terms often indicate better quality. Research brand reputation and customer service to avoid issues down the line.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. What is LiFePO4 battery technology and why is it better?
LiFePO4 (lithium iron phosphate) is a type of lithium battery known for its long lifespan and safety. It can handle thousands of charge cycles without significant degradation, unlike standard lithium-ion batteries. This makes it ideal for solar storage where reliability and durability are key.
2. How do I calculate the battery capacity I need for my home?
Start by listing the wattage of essential devices (e.g., fridge: 150W, lights: 10W each) and estimate daily usage hours. Multiply wattage by hours to get watt-hours, then add them up. For example, if you need 500Wh per day, a 1000Wh battery gives you a safety buffer. Always overshoot by 20-30% to account for inefficiencies.
3. Can I use these power stations with my existing solar panels?
Most units are compatible with standard solar panels, but check the voltage and connector types. MPPT controllers in better models optimize charging from various panels. If unsure, consult the manufacturer’s specs or stick with included solar kits for hassle-free setup.
4. What's the difference between pure sine wave and modified sine wave AC outlets?
Pure sine wave provides clean, stable power similar to grid electricity, safe for sensitive electronics like medical devices and computers. Modified sine wave can cause issues with some gadgets. Always choose pure sine wave for versatility and device protection.
5. How long do these batteries typically last before needing replacement?
It depends on usage and battery type. LiFePO4 batteries often last 10+ years or 3000+ cycles, while standard lithium-ion may last 2-5 years. Proper maintenance, like avoiding full discharges, can extend lifespan significantly.
